What Is a Corporate Social Responsibility Dashboard in Google Sheets?

A Corporate Social Responsibility Dashboard is a centralized analytics tool that tracks CSR initiatives, budgets, spending, and impact metrics in one place. Built in Google Sheets, this dashboard allows CSR teams, finance teams, and leadership to monitor performance in real time.

Because it runs in Google Sheets, the dashboard offers:

  • Real-time collaboration
  • Automatic calculations
  • Interactive charts
  • Easy customization
  • No expensive BI tools

Most importantly, it converts raw CSR data into actionable insights.

Why Do Organizations Need a CSR Dashboard?

CSR programs often involve multiple departments, locations, and partners. Without a structured dashboard, teams struggle to answer basic questions such as:

  • How many CSR projects are active?
  • How much budget is allocated versus spent?
  • Which regions receive the most impact?
  • Which programs deliver the best efficiency?
  • Are CSR investments producing measurable outcomes?

A CSR Dashboard in Google Sheets solves these challenges by creating a single source of truth.

Overview Sheet Tab – High-Level CSR Performance

The Overview sheet gives a quick summary of CSR performance using KPI cards and charts. This section is ideal for leadership reviews and board presentations.

Overview Cards (KPIs)

1. Number of Projects

Shows the total number of CSR projects currently tracked.

Why it matters:
It indicates CSR scale and organizational commitment.

2. Total Budget (USD)

Displays the total budget allocated to CSR initiatives.

Why it matters:
It reflects financial planning and investment level.

3. Actual Spend (USD)

Shows how much budget has been utilized.

Why it matters:
It helps track spending discipline and execution.

4. Beneficiaries Reached

Represents the total number of individuals impacted by CSR initiatives.

Why it matters:
This is a direct indicator of social impact.

5. Average Spend Efficiency Rating

Measures how effectively funds convert into outcomes.

Why it matters:
Higher efficiency means better impact per dollar spent.

Overview Charts

Projects by Region

Shows how CSR initiatives are distributed geographically.

Insight gained:
Helps identify regional focus and coverage gaps.

Projects by Status

Displays projects by status such as ongoing, completed, or planned.

Insight gained:
Improves project tracking and governance.

Beneficiaries Reached by Department

Shows which departments contribute most to CSR impact.

Insight gained:
Encourages accountability and internal engagement.

Beneficiaries Reached by Region

Highlights geographic impact distribution.

Insight gained:
Supports region-specific strategy adjustments.

Actual Spend (USD) by CSR Program

Displays spending by program type.

Insight gained:
Identifies high-investment initiatives.

Opportunities for Improvement in CSR Tracking

Although the dashboard is powerful, organizations can enhance it further:

  • Add project-level risk indicators

  • Track long-term beneficiary outcomes

  • Include ESG alignment metrics

  • Integrate donor or partner data

  • Add year-over-year comparisons

  • Introduce automated alerts for overspending

These improvements elevate CSR governance maturity.

Best Practices for Using the CSR Dashboard

  • Update data regularly

  • Maintain consistent definitions

  • Review spend efficiency monthly

  • Use charts during leadership reviews

  • Encourage departments to own CSR outcomes

  • Protect sensitive data with access controls
